Bill Summary

An act relating to required life skills instruction; amending s. 1003.42, F.S.; revising the required instruction in specified life skills to include career readiness, financial literacy, and home economics; providing an effective date.

AI Summary

This bill amends Florida's education law to expand required life skills instruction for K-12 students by adding three new components to the existing curriculum: career readiness, financial literacy, and home economics. Specifically, the bill modifies section 1003.42 of Florida Statutes to include these additional topics within the existing life skills educational framework, which already covers areas such as self-awareness, responsible decision-making, relationship skills, and career planning. For students in grades 9-12, the bill requires more detailed instruction on career preparation, including creating résumés, exploring career pathways, practicing interview skills, understanding workplace ethics and law, and developing self-motivation. The new financial literacy and home economics components will provide students with practical knowledge about managing personal finances and basic life management skills. The changes will be implemented starting July 1, 2025, giving schools time to prepare and integrate these new instructional requirements into their existing curriculum. The bill aims to enhance students' practical life skills and better prepare them for future personal and professional challenges.
